Output fe58f296218562da76cbe548fc87ee0c3e897e7d17f2c7cb7b909e509be72dbb:0

value
20473700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2362f049c7e60c4752b686c419a22e3af2fb287 OP_EQUALVERIFY OP_CHECKSIG
address
1JhtzxoTDWr5DKFoMKTeybw9zyyaRdx3jU
transaction
fe58f296218562da76cbe548fc87ee0c3e897e7d17f2c7cb7b909e509be72dbb
spent
true